SIGMA hard X-ray observations of the Galactic Bulge source SLX 1735-269.

The deep Galactic Center and Bulge survey carried out by the SIGMA/GRANAT telescope in the 35-1300keV range has shown that SLX 1735-269 is one of the ten persistent sources of hard X-ray emission of the region. In this paper we report the detailed analysis of the whole SIGMA data base on this peculiar object. The average high energy spectrum can be described by a thin thermal Bremsstrahlung with a temperature of =~50keV or alternatively by a power-law model with a photon index =~-3. Its spectral and temporal hard X-ray characteristics resemble those of the bursting LMXBs of the region like GX 354-00. However the light curve shows little variability, an uncommon feature for hard X-ray sources.
